About the material - polycarbonate

Polycarbonate honeycomb is a modern material. Despite its "youth", it enjoys great popularity among consumers. Polycarbonate is a plastic material with very good technical characteristics:

  • High light conductivity;
  • Light weight and flexibility;
  • A wide range of possible temperature operating modes (from -50 to +120 degrees);
  • Good thermal insulation;
  • Protection against ultraviolet radiation;
  • Durability of the structure;
  • Simplicity of cutting material.

Manufacturing of greenhouses from polycarbonate

The construction process takes place in several stages:

1. Construction of the foundation. The simplest version of the construction of the base is a frame of timber. For this purpose, a material of 100 x 100 mm size is suitable. Preliminary, the tree should be covered with a protective layer of the "Penatex". Such a foundation will last at least five years. If desired, you can make the foundation stronger by using blocks of FBS. The most durable is the ribbon foundation. The process of its erection is the longest, but it's worth it. The quality and reliability of the tape-type foundation is the best option.

2. Manufacturing of a frame of a greenhouse. The polycarbonate greenhouse with its own hands is beneficial in that the structure can be made the right size, depending on the area of the land. When assembling the frame, provide an opening for the door and window. It is recommended to use a galvanized profile for the construction. The structure is fixed to the foundation with the help of special fasteners (self-tapping screws). For greater strength of the structure, it is expedient to provide "stiffeners". Cross lathing and longitudinal elements will give the construction a good stability.

When cutting the material, it is necessary to take into account the standard parameter of the panels in order to save costs. In addition, it is necessary to take into account such features as the thermal expansion of panels, the load of atmospheric precipitation, the radii from the bending of the arch type structure.

3. Installation of the heating system. The device of a greenhouse made of polycarbonate includes the presence of heaters. Heating devices are set based on the area of the glazing space, multiplied by the coefficient of thermal conductivity and the difference in temperature. The resulting result indicates the necessary heat demand in kilocalories (1 W = 0.86 Kcal / h). Heating devices should be placed evenly around the perimeter of the room.

4. Providing the right soil. An important factor for a good growth of vegetables is the soil. Its optimal composition is as follows: humus - three parts, sand - one part, turf - two parts. In addition, one bucket of the prepared mixture requires the addition of components: potassium sulfate, urea, superphosphate in amounts of one teaspoon of each substance. In order to obtain a good harvest, the soil in the greenhouse needs to be updated annually.

Installation of a greenhouse made of polycarbonate

Installation of the greenhouse is carried out using split or integral profiles. Sealing of the top profiles is provided by a self-adhesive aluminum tape. Perforated tape is used for the bottom of the panels. Both ends of the arches of the greenhouse are closed with a perforated belt, followed by closing the ends with a profile.

In order to ensure the withdrawal of condensate, the panel is placed so that the water drains out. For this, it is recommended to drill a few holes in the polycarbonate.

The material sheets must be inserted into the grooves of the profile and fixed to the frame with self-tapping screws with thermal washers. This method will avoid deterioration of the polycarbonate and close the access of cold air through the fixing holes.
